SAN FRANCISCO - Facebook Inc is making it harder to find user groups associated with the term “Boogaloo,” which refers to a potential U.S. civil war or the collapse of civilization, the company said on Thursday.
Facebook will no longer recommend such groups to members of similar associations, a spokeswoman for the world’s largest social media network said. Facebook said it made the changes early in the week. “We felt we needed to take this action given discussions of potential use of violence,” the spokeswoman said on condition she not be named.
On May 1, Facebook banned the use of Boogaloo and related terms when they accompany pictures of weapons and calls to action, such as preparing for conflict.
